# Break-Glass: Catalog Cache Invalidation

Scope: the Pinrow product catalog at Veldstone Retail. If stale prices persist after a purge and the Hollowmere invalidation queue is wedged, use break-glass to flush the edge tier directly. Contractors: get verbal sign-off from the catalog lead first. Steps: open the Hollowmere admin shell, select emergency-flush, confirm the tenant, and run it once — repeated flushes thrash the origin. Access is logged and expires after 20 minutes. Unseal the admin shell with the passphrase below.

recovery phrase for kahop-tajog: istix-casvan

// REINDEX_BATCH_CAP limits docs per shard pass in the Tallowfield
// nightly search reindex. Raising it starves the ingest queue;
// lowering it overruns the maintenance window. 5000 is the tested
// sweet spot. Change only with a soak run. Verified against the
// build noted below.

session token of bawif-hahog = htk6_ac5981

TURN-208: Gatevale turnstile counters at the Merrow Field pilot double-count when a rotation reverses mid-cycle. Attendance totals drift roughly 2% high per event. The debounce window fix is implemented, reviewed by Ilsa, and soak-tested across two simulated match days without drift. Ready for your cut; the candidate build is identified below.

trace token, tagag-tafog: htk6_5ed18c